Frequently Asked Questions
Q: What is the size of the StarTech.com 4 Bay SSD/HDD Hard Drive Eraser?A: The size of the StarTech.com 4 Bay SSD/HDD Hard Drive Eraser is eight point two inches in length, three point eight inches in width, and one point two inches in height.
Q: What materials are used in the construction of this eraser?A: This hard drive eraser is primarily made of steel, which adds durability and stability during use.
Q: How many drives can be erased simultaneously with this device?A: You can securely erase up to four drives simultaneously with this device, making it efficient for bulk erasing.
Q: How do I operate the StarTech.com hard drive eraser?A: To operate the eraser, connect the drives, select an erase mode using the LCD display, and press the start button to initiate the process.
Q: Is this device suitable for beginners?A: Yes, this device is suitable for beginners due to its user-friendly interface and clear LCD display for easy navigation.
Q: Can I connect this eraser to a computer for data transfer?A: Yes, you can connect a single drive to a laptop or PC using the USB three point zero SuperSpeed port for data transfer before erasing.

Q: What safety features does this eraser have?A: This eraser meets NIST and DOD standards for secure erasing, ensuring that data is permanently removed from the drives.

Q: What type of drives can be used with this eraser?A: This eraser is compatible with two point five inch and three point five inch SATA SSDs and HDDs, as well as IDE and mSATA drives with adapters.
Q: Can I upgrade the firmware on this device?A: Yes, the firmware on this hard drive eraser is upgradeable to comply with future DOD and government standards.

Q: Is there a printed erase confirmation feature?A: Yes, this eraser includes an RS232 printer port for printing results and drive information for your records.
Q: How many erase modes does the device offer?A: The StarTech.com hard drive eraser offers nine erase modes, including quick erase and multiple pass overwrites.
Q: Is this product compliant with TAA regulations?A: Yes, this hard drive eraser is compliant with TAA regulations, ensuring it meets specific government procurement requirements.
